Why Live in Deerfield

Deerfield, New Hampshire, is a rural village with approximately 5,000 residents, located 20 miles from Manchester. The area is characterized by dense forests, streams, and rolling hillsides, offering a peaceful country lifestyle. Deerfield's town center features a few shops, restaurants, and pubs, contributing to the local charm. The village is renowned for the Deerfield Fair, "New England’s Oldest Family Fair," which attracts thousands of visitors each autumn with its amusement park rides and agricultural events. Homes in Deerfield are primarily Colonials, Cape Cods, cottages, and Traditional designs, many dating back to the 1700s and 1800s, situated on large lots ranging from three to ten acres. Pleasant Lake and Northwood Lake provide opportunities for boating and fishing, while Pawtuckaway State Park and Bear Brook State Park offer extensive trails for hiking, biking, and snowshoeing. The town center includes several shops, restaurants, and a library, with the nearest grocery store located 8 miles away in Northwood. Deerfield Community School serves kindergarten through eighth grade, and high school students attend Concord High School or the highly rated Coe-Brown Northwood Academy. Residents benefit from a low crime risk compared to the national average and have access to Manchester and Concord for additional amenities and services, although a car is necessary for commuting.

How much do you need to make to afford a house in Deerfield?
The median home price in Deerfield is $595,000. If you put a 20% down payment of $119,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.11%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$2,890 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ities.
